How can companies effectively measure and track the impact of their positive company culture on financial performance in order to ensure continued success and growth?
Companies can effectively measure the impact of their positive company culture on financial performance by conducting regular employee engagement surveys to assess satisfaction and productivity levels. They can also track key performance indicators related to employee retention, absenteeism rates, and overall job satisfaction. Additionally, companies can analyze financial metrics such as revenue growth, profitability, and return on investment to evaluate the correlation between a positive company culture and financial success. By consistently monitoring and analyzing these data points, companies can ensure that their positive company culture is contributing to continued success and growth.
